Bill Summary
For legislation to establish a clean energy education program to provide funding to the Commonwealth’s technical and vocational high schools. Education.
AI Summary
This bill aims to promote energy and economic resilience through clean energy education and job pathway programs. It establishes a clean energy education program within the Massachusetts Department of Elementary and Secondary Education to provide funding to the Commonwealth's technical and vocational high schools for programs related to clean and renewable energy, energy storage, electric vehicles, and clean energy manufacturing. The bill also directs electric and gas distribution companies and municipal aggregators to annually transfer at least $20 million to the Department of Elementary and Secondary Education for these programs, without reducing the amount expended on low-income programs. Additionally, the bill requires electric distribution companies to file annual electric distribution system resiliency reports and establishes a rebate program for Massachusetts-based companies installing and manufacturing energy storage systems.
